On May 29, Mötley Crüe frontman Vince Neil played his first show since the coronavirus pandemic at the Boone Iowa River Valley Festival in Boone, Iowa. During Sammy Hagar & The Circle’s May 26 show at Dr. Phillips Center in Orlando, Florida, the band were joined onstage by Mötley Crüe’s Vince Neil for a cover of Led Zeppelin’s “Rock And Roll.” You can see fan-filmed footage of that below: View this post on Instagram A post shared by Sammy Hagar (@sammyhagar)
Nikki Sixx (Mötley Crüe, Sixx:A.M.) has confirmed that he is working on new music. However, it is unclear which project the material will be used for. Sixx said the following: “Back in Los Angeles to record a few new tracks, drop something new this week and finish my book.”
Mötley Crüe have announced that they will be celebrating their 40th anniversary with a series of re-releases and fan activations. The first release is a digital remaster of “Girls, Girls, Girls,” which will be available on June 11. Pre-orders can be found HERE.
